Position Summary:
Under general supervision, plans, evaluates and implements treatment programs for physical therapy patients. Modifies treatment plans in accordance with patient progress.
Responsibilities
Clinical practice - including evaluation and treatment of patients
- Performs patient evaluations (initial, progress, and discharge evaluations), establishes treatment plans, makes recommendations, and sets goals in accordance with patient needs and evidence based practice.
- Meets established targets for passive/active treatment ratios.
- Involves patient and family in treatment, education and goal setting.
- Coordinates with other medical personnel regarding patients progress, needs and discharge planning.
- Demonstrates knowledge and competency including providing for age-specific needs of the population served.
- Serves as a resource person for support staff and other health system staff.
- Assists with training, orientation and supervision of support staff.
- Assumes responsibility for the educational development of assigned students.
- Maintains and updates patient documentation in accordance with professional, departmental, organizational, and payer guidelines and timeframes.
- Maintains established targets for compliance with chart audits.
